2014 Volkswagen Caddy — MOT failures & pass rate

The 2014 Volkswagen Caddy passed 80.2% of its 73,796 recorded MOT tests. Against vans of a similar age (23.0% fail rate), the 2014 Caddy comes out 3.2pp better. Failures cluster in suspension, lighting & signalling and tyres.

What the MOT record shows

Suspension dominates the failure mix at 10.2% of all tests — 3.2 points clear of lighting & signalling, so it is the first thing to check.

At component level the recurring items are pins and bushes, tread depth and washers — pins and bushes alone was recorded 5,769 times.

A 150k+ example is materially riskier than a 0-30k one: 22.4% versus 12.0%.

Advisories point at the next bill rather than this one: tyres was flagged on 27.0% of tests without failing them.

The trend is worsening — 16.4% of tests failed in 2021 against 22.6% in 2025, the usual pattern as a fleet ages.

Failure rate by mileage

Higher-mileage cars tend to fail more — often the most useful guide to real condition.

MOT fail rate by recorded mileage 0-30k 12.0% 30-60k 14.8% 60-90k 18.8% 90-120k 20.3% 120-150k 22.5% 150k+ 22.4%
MOT fail rate by recorded mileage band.
Fail rate by recorded mileage — 2014 Caddy
Mileage band Tests Fail rate
0-30k 1,747 12.0%
30-60k 8,618 14.8%
60-90k 18,816 18.8%
90-120k 20,056 20.3%
120-150k 13,488 22.5%
150k+ 11,050 22.4%

Frequently asked questions

How many 2014 Volkswagen Caddys pass their MOT?

80.2% of the 73,796 2014 Volkswagen Caddy MOT tests in this dataset passed — a 19.8% fail rate.

What is the most common MOT failure on a 2014 Volkswagen Caddy?

Suspension, recorded in 10.2% of tests, followed by lighting & signalling (7.0%).

Does the 2014 Caddy get worse with mileage?

Its MOT fail rate rises from 12.0% in the 0-30k band to 22.4% in the 150k+ band.

Methodology & source. Based on 73,796 MOT tests. Dataset: DVSA MOT testing data (2021,2022,2023,2024,2025). Data last updated 2026-07-27. Figures reflect MOT-testable defects only — read the methodology for how these are calculated and what they don't measure.
